The Big Chief 50K trail race is a loop course on a mix of single track and fire road in the scenic forests between Lake Tahoe and Truckee. You will run through mighty trees, take in breathtaking views and conquer rocky summits on your journey. The course travels between 6000 – 7500 feet of elevation and you will gain approximately 4500 feet during the run.

The race starts and finishes in the Village at Northstar Resort in Truckee, CA. Runners will be supported by 5 aid stations on the course with water, Electrolyte beverage, fruit and salty snacks. At the finish, you will be rewarded with cold beverages, including beer, snacks, and a finisher medal.

All participants will also receive a technical race shirt. The cut off time for official finishers is 8.5 hours but we do our best to accommodate everyone that wants to finish. Medical support will be provided on course and at the finish. The race takes place the day after the Tahoe Trail 100K Mountain Bike Race and follows roughly the same course with a few adjustments.
